legongju.com
我们一直在努力
2024-12-23 17:44 | 星期一

Kotlin命令行应用开发怎样提高效率

在Kotlin中开发命令行应用时,可以使用一些工具和库来提高效率。以下是一些建议:

  1. 使用IntelliJ IDEA:IntelliJ IDEA是一个功能强大的Kotlin集成开发环境(IDE),它提供了许多有用的功能,如代码自动补全、代码重构、调试和测试等。使用IntelliJ IDEA可以大大提高开发效率。

  2. 使用Kotlin脚语言:Kotlin脚语言是一种轻量级的编程语言,它可以直接在命令行中运行。使用Kotlin脚语言可以快速地编写和测试代码片段,而无需创建完整的项目。

  3. 使用Gradle或Maven:Gradle和Maven是构建自动化工具,它们可以帮助你管理项目的依赖关系、编译、打包和部署等任务。使用Gradle或Maven可以简化构建过程,提高开发效率。

  4. 使用Kotlin标准库和第三方库:Kotlin拥有丰富的标准库和第三方库,可以帮助你快速实现各种功能。在使用这些库时,务必阅读文档,了解它们的使用方法和优缺点,以便在项目中做出明智的选择。

  5. 使用代码生成器:代码生成器可以根据预定义的模板自动生成代码。使用代码生成器可以减少手动编写重复代码的工作量,提高开发效率。

  6. 使用单元测试和集成测试:编写单元测试和集成测试可以帮助你确保代码的正确性和稳定性。使用Kotlin的测试框架(如JUnit和TestNG)可以方便地编写和执行测试用例。

  7. 使用版本控制系统:使用版本控制系统(如Git)可以帮助你跟踪代码的变更历史,方便地在不同版本之间切换和协作开发。

  8. 使用代码审查:在开发过程中,进行代码审查可以帮助你发现潜在的问题和改进点。使用代码审查工具(如GitHub的Pull Request或GitLab的Merge Request)可以方便地进行代码审查。

  9. 使用持续集成和持续部署(CI/CD):持续集成和持续部署可以帮助你自动化构建、测试和部署过程,提高开发效率。使用Jenkins、Travis CI等工具可以实现CI/CD。

  10. 保持学习和关注新技术:作为一名开发者,保持学习和关注新技术是非常重要的。通过学习新的编程语言、工具和库,你可以不断提高自己的技能,提高开发效率。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/14916.html

相关推荐

  • Kotlin移动开发如何优化界面

    Kotlin移动开发如何优化界面

    在Kotlin移动开发中,优化界面是一个重要的任务,可以提高用户体验并减少资源消耗。以下是一些建议,可以帮助你优化Kotlin移动应用的界面: 使用合适的布局:根据...

  • Kotlin移动开发怎样提升用户体验

    Kotlin移动开发怎样提升用户体验

    在Kotlin移动开发中,提升用户体验的关键在于优化应用的性能、响应速度、交互性和视觉体验。以下是一些建议: 性能优化: 使用Kotlin协程来处理异步任务,避免回...

  • Kotlin移动开发如何设计模式

    Kotlin移动开发如何设计模式

    在Kotlin移动开发中,设计模式可以帮助我们解决常见的编程问题,提高代码的可读性、可维护性和可扩展性。以下是一些常用的设计模式及其在Kotlin移动开发中的应用...

  • Kotlin移动开发能提高可读性吗

    Kotlin移动开发能提高可读性吗

    Kotlin移动开发确实可以提高代码的可读性。Kotlin作为一种现代编程语言,其设计目标之一就是让开发者能够编写更简洁、更富表现力的代码,从而提高代码的可读性和...

  • Kotlin命令行应用开发适合哪些场景

    Kotlin命令行应用开发适合哪些场景

    Kotlin命令行应用开发适合多种场景,包括但不限于: 脚本编写与自动化:Kotlin简洁的语法和强大的函数式编程特性使其非常适合编写脚本,可以轻松处理文件操作、系...

  • Kotlin命令行应用开发如何测试功能

    Kotlin命令行应用开发如何测试功能

    在Kotlin中开发命令行应用程序后,您可以使用以下方法测试功能: 使用JUnit进行单元测试:
    对于命令行应用程序的每个功能模块,您可以编写一个或多个JUnit测...

  • Kotlin命令行应用开发需要哪些基础

    Kotlin命令行应用开发需要哪些基础

    Kotlin命令行应用开发需要掌握一些基础知识和技能,包括开发环境的配置、基本语法、类和对象的使用、可空性处理、扩展函数、Lambda表达式、集合操作、异常处理等...

  • Kotlin命令行应用开发怎样优化代码

    Kotlin命令行应用开发怎样优化代码

    在Kotlin中开发命令行应用时,可以通过以下方法优化代码: 使用Kotlin标准库和函数式编程特性:充分利用Kotlin的标准库和函数式编程特性(如高阶函数、扩展函数、...